How To Write Resume For Civilian Technician

  • Highlight your technical skills and experience in your resume.
  • Quantify your accomplishments to demonstrate your impact.
  • Use keywords from the job description in your resume.
  • Proofread your resume carefully before submitting it.
  • Tailor your resume to each job you apply for.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’s) For Civilian Technician

  • What is a Civilian Technician?

    A Civilian Technician is a highly skilled professional who provides technical support to military organizations. They are responsible for maintaining, repairing, and troubleshooting equipment, as well as providing technical assistance to users.

  • What are the qualifications for a Civilian Technician?

    Civilian Technicians typically have an Associate’s or Bachelor’s degree in a technical field, such as engineering, computer science, or information technology. They also have experience in a technical environment, and are proficient in troubleshooting and repairing equipment.

  • What are the job duties of a Civilian Technician?

    Civilian Technicians perform a variety of job duties, including maintaining and repairing equipment, troubleshooting problems, providing technical support to users, and developing and implementing technical solutions.

  • What is the work environment of a Civilian Technician?

    Civilian Technicians typically work in a technical environment, such as a laboratory or workshop. They may also work in an office setting, providing technical support to users.

  • What is the salary of a Civilian Technician?

    The salary of a Civilian Technician varies depending on their experience, skills, and location. However, the average salary for a Civilian Technician is around $60,000 per year.

  • What are the benefits of being a Civilian Technician?

    Civilian Technicians enjoy a number of benefits, including a competitive salary, health insurance, retirement benefits, and paid time off.

  • What are the career prospects for a Civilian Technician?

    Civilian Technicians have a variety of career prospects. They can advance to management positions, or they can specialize in a particular area of expertise.
